A two-vehicle crash on East 19th Street and Pecan Street sends one juvenile to the hospital after a driver fell asleep at the wheel on Monday, June 30, around 3 p.m. According to SAPD, a GMC Sierra was driving westbound on 19th st when the Chevy Blazer, driving east, fell asleep at the wheel, causing the vehicle to drive over the center line, causing a collision. Both drivers were issued citations. The Chevy driver for driving left of center, and the GMC driver for failing to have a driver’s license.
